Cleveland Indians 4, Oakland Athletics 1

Cleveland Indians ab   r   h rbi
Bell 3b 4 0 1 0
McCraw 1b 4 2 2 1
Hendrick cf 5 2 2 3
Robinson dh 0 0 0 0
  Gamble ph,dh 2 0 0 0
Spikes rf 4 0 1 0
Duffy ss 4 0 0 0
Berry lf 4 0 1 0
Crosby 2b 3 0 0 0
Ashby c 1 0 0 0
Eckersley p 0 0 0 0
Totals 31 4 7 4
Oakland Athletics ab   r   h rbi
Campaneris ss 4 0 1 0
Bando 3b 3 0 1 1
Jackson rf 4 0 0 0
Rudi 1b 4 0 0 0
Williams dh 4 0 1 0
Tenace c 1 0 0 0
  Fosse c 2 0 0 0
  North ph 1 0 1 0
Washington cf 4 0 0 0
Mangual lf 3 0 0 0
Garner 2b 2 1 1 0
  Holt ph 1 0 1 0
  Hopkins pr 0 0 0 0
  Martinez 2b 0 0 0 0
Holtzman p 0 0 0 0
  Lindblad p 0 0 0 0
  Todd p 0 0 0 0
Totals 33 1 6 1
Cleveland 102 010 000470
Oakland 000 001 000160
  Cleveland Indians IP H R ER BB SO
Eckersley  W (3-0) 9.0 6 1 1 1 5
Totals
9.0
6
1
1
1
5
  Oakland Athletics IP H R ER BB SO
Holtzman  L (3-6) 2.2 4 3 3 3 1
  Lindblad   3.1 3 1 1 3 2
  Todd   3.0 0 0 0 2 2
Totals
9.0
7
4
4
8
5

  E–None.  2B–Oakland Bando (5,off Eckersley).  HR–Cleveland McCraw (2,1st inning off Holtzman 0 on, 1 out); Hendrick 2 (9,3rd inning off Holtzman 1 on, 2 out,5th inning off Lindblad 0 on, 1 out).  SH–Crosby (1,off Lindblad).  IBB–Bell (2,by Lindblad).  SB–Ashby (2,2nd base off Lindblad/Fosse); Hopkins (8,2nd base off Eckersley/Ashby).  CS–Ashby (1,2nd base by Holtzman/Tenace).  IBB–Lindblad (4,Bell).  U-HP–Armando Rodriguez, 1B–Bill Haller, 2B–Rich Garcia, 3B–Ron Luciano.  T–2:15.  A–7,754.
